The world of communication is constantly shifting. While some advancements bring us closer, others creep in with less noble intentions. One such development is ringless voicemail, a strategy that permits unsolicited messages to land directly in your inbox without ever ringing your phone.

Concealed behind its seemingly benign nature, ringless voicemail has become a undetectable invasion, overwhelming unsuspecting individuals with unwanted calls and offers. Companies may use it for legitimate purposes like appointment reminders, but the vast number of ringless voicemail messages are from telemarketers looking to prey upon your information.

Stopping the Flow: How to Block Ringless Voicemail

Are you tired of getting infuriating ringless voicemails that leave calls on your phone? These unwanted communications can be a real headache, but there are steps you can take to stop them in their tracks. First, examine your voicemail settings and make sure that unknown callers cannot record messages. You can also block the sources that are sending these spammy messages to your phone company.

Another effective tactic is to install a dedicated call blocking app. These apps can scan incoming calls and automatically block those from known spammers or suspicious numbers. Some apps even allow you to design custom rules based on caller ID, area code, or other criteria. By taking these proactive measures, you can regain control over your voicemail and minimize the inconvenience of ringless voicemails.

Grasping Ringless Voicemail and Protecting Yourself

Ringless voicemail employs a clever method of delivering messages directly to your voicemail storage without ringing your phone. While it can be useful for organizations, it also presents potential risks. Fraudsters may manipulate this system to fraud unsuspecting individuals. Consequently, it's vital to know about ringless voicemail and establish measures to defend yourself.

  • Be cautious of unsolicited calls to your voicemail.
  • Confirm the caller's identity before responding.
  • Refrain from revealing sensitive data over voicemail.
